Start Planning Early
One of the most effective ways to ensure a seamless move is to begin planning as early as possible. Moving internationally involves various logistical steps, so allowing ample time for organisation is essential. Ideally, preparations should begin at least two to three months in advance to sort through belongings, arrange removals, and complete any necessary paperwork.
Creating a checklist can help maintain organisation, breaking down tasks into manageable steps such as securing accommodation in the UK, contacting removal companies, and notifying utility providers about the move. Early planning minimises the risk of overlooking essential details and provides a greater sense of control throughout the process.

Organise Essential Paperwork
Relocating to the UK requires a range of documentation, which should be gathered well in advance to avoid last-minute stress. Key documents include passports, visas (if applicable), birth certificates, and health insurance details. Families moving with children may also need additional paperwork, such as school records.
Property-related documentation for any residence in Portugal, including rental agreements or sale contracts, should also be organised. Additionally, notifying financial institutions about a change of address is essential to ensure continued access to banking services. Having all necessary paperwork in place before the move can help ensure a smooth transition.

Notify Key Services and Organisations
Before departing Portugal, several service providers and organisations must be informed of the move. Utility services, internet providers, and other ongoing contracts may need to be cancelled or transferred. Healthcare providers, such as doctors and dentists, should also be notified to ensure continuity of care.
Tax authorities in both Portugal and the UK should be updated to prevent any financial discrepancies. Those planning to work in the UK may need to register for National Insurance upon arrival. Taking care of these administrative details before the move can help prevent any disruptions during the transition.
